Description
Key responsibilities:As Senior Manager for Compliance, you will oversee Asia compliance activities, manage regulatory engagements and audits, support initiatives, address risks and breaches, and report key matters to senior management.
- Support implementation and enhancement of the compliance program, including policies, controls, and procedures to ensure regulatory adherence
- Coordinate regulatory reviews, examinations, inquiries, and audits to ensure effective and timely engagement
- Manage regulatory filings, licensing, and registration requirements
- Assess regulatory developments and provide compliance guidance for new initiatives, products, and process changes
- Identify, escalate, and oversee resolution of compliance risks, breaches, and control weaknesses, including remediation tracking and reporting
- Collaborate with regulators (e.g. SFC, MPFA) and apply relevant laws, regulations, and industry best practices in compliance management
- Partner with cross-functional stakeholders and support compliance reporting, training, marketing review, and management information for leadership and committees
Candidate profile:
To excel in this role, you bring asset management compliance experience, strong knowledge of SFO and Codes of Conduct (Type 1/4/9), excellent stakeholder skills, and a proactive, solutions-focused mindset.
- Strong expertise in asset management compliance with 8+ years' experience and a degree in Business, Finance, Accounting or related discipline
- Deep knowledge of SFO, Codes of Conduct, and Type 1, 4, 9 regulations (MPFSO knowledge a plus)
- Proven ability to operate in complex, matrix organisations and navigate cross-functional environments
- Strong stakeholder management skills with experience engaging regulators and senior executives
- Excellent communication, presentation, and influencing skills with ability to produce clear management and committee materials
- Solutions-oriented mindset with strong regulatory risk awareness, problem-solving ability, and ability to drive issues to resolution
- Proficient in Microsoft Office and responsible use of AI tools to enhance analysis, reporting, and workflow efficiency
